Town U14s put in a great display

BANBRIDGE Town Juniors U14s travelled to Barbour Playing Fields on Saturday and duly secured a top four finish with a workmanlike 3-0 win against Shankill.

After defeating Glentoran 3-2 the previous Saturday the Juniors were confident and controlled in their approach and took a 1-0 lead after 15 minutes; Curtis Stewart expertly dispatching a penalty after Burns was upended in the box.

Playing assured passing football, the locals increased their lead just five minutes later. Ace marksman Luke Diamond scored with a neat finish.

The Juniors added their third just before the half-time break, again Curtis Stewart with a far post header from a superb Neil Cherry cross.

There was to be no further scoring in the second period and the Juniors looked comfortable throughout. This was another superb team performance from this U14 squad who have been magnificent this season.
